How does your compensation at University compare to the industry average?

Geographical Location: Salaries in higher education vary significantly depending on the region or country you're in. Position and Experience: Compensation varies depending on whether you are an assistant professor, associate professor, or full professor. Someone with 15 years of experience, like you, would typically earn more than those who are just starting out in academia. Industry vs. Academia: Generally, professionals in the sector often earn more than those in academia. In STEM fields like physics or engineering, those working in private industry, especially in technology or engineering companies, may have significantly higher salaries due to the profitability of the private sector. Benefits and Perks: University compensation packages often include additional benefits such as retirement contributions, health insurance, and tuition discounts, which might not be as generous in the industry, depending on the company.
